應用服務器提供應用服務,接口服務器是提供給第三方調用的服務,主要是為了自己的應用得安全性,所以只把能供給第三方調用的東西封裝在接口服務器。應用服務器為客戶端提供對業務邏輯的訪問。這種服務器根據客戶端的請求,將數據轉換為動態內容。應用服務器的搭建很多時候依賴于應用程序的開發語言,各種編程語言生態下對應不同的軟件,比如使用java語言開發的項目 通常選擇tomcat或JBoss等作為程序運行的應用服務器,而使用python語言開發web應用一般會選擇django等Python框架下的軟件,來作為它的應用服務器。
常用的應用服務器:Tomcat應用服務器、Weblogic應用服務器。
1、Tomcat應用服務器
Tomcat服務器是一個免費的開放源代碼的Web應用服務器,它運行時占用的系統資源小,擴展性好,支持負載平衡與郵件服務等開發應用系統常用的功能;Tomcat部分是Apache服務器的擴展,但它是獨立運行的,所以當運行tomcat時,它實際上作為一個與Apache 獨立的進程單獨運行的。Tomcat技術先進、性能穩定且免費,深受Java愛好者的喜愛,并得到了部分軟件開發商的認可,成為目前比較流行的Web應用服務器。
2、Weblogic應用服務器
Web Logic是美國bea公司出品的一個application server確切的說是一個基于Javaee架構的中間件,BEA Web Logic是用于開發、集成、部署和管理大型分布式Web應用、網絡應用和數據庫應用的Java應用服務器。將Java的動態功能和Java Enterprise標準的安全性引入大型網絡應用的開發、集成、部署和管理之中,是用來構建網站的必要軟件,擁有解析發布網頁等功能,它是用純java開發的。
了解更多服務器及資訊,請關注夢飛科技官方網站,感謝您的支持!